Downward-inserting type conversion connection node structure of variable-cross-section steel column
The invention discloses a variable cross-section steel column down-inserting type conversion connection node structure which comprises a small circular pipe column, the end of the small circular pipe column is fixedly connected with a conversion taper pipe, the conversion taper pipe is sleeved and fixedly provided with a large circular pipe column, and the interior of the large circular pipe column is hollow to form a mounting space. A first transverse partition plate and a second transverse partition plate are fixedly mounted at the two ends, in the height direction, of the conversion taper pipe in the mounting space correspondingly, and a plurality of radial stiffening ribs are fixedly mounted on the side, away from the conversion taper pipe, of the second transverse partition plate in the axis direction of the large tubular column. The radial stiffening ribs are fixedly connected with the large circular pipe column, the radial stiffening ribs are fixedly connected through the annular stiffening ribs, and the first bracket and the second bracket are fixedly installed on the two sides, perpendicular to the height direction, of the large circular pipe column correspondingly. And compared with a conventional joint, the material loss is reduced, the beam-column joint cannot be weakened, the rigidity of the joint and the stability of the structure are improved, and the high popularization value is achieved.
